Selecting a recognized driving school is essential. The driving trainer will guide you through theoretical and practical training. Try to find schools that are certified and use flexible schedules.
Action 3: Theoretical Training
To prepare for the theoretical test, trainees need to participate in obligatory class sessions covering topics like traffic regulations, vehicle operation, and roadway safety. Upon conclusion, trainees take the theoretical exam.
Step 4: Practical Training
The next phase involves hands-on training with a qualified instructor. Depending upon the category, useful lessons range from 12 to 30 driving hours, including night driving and FüHrerschein Legal Kaufen highway experience.

Can I drive in Germany with a foreign driving license?
Yes, visitors can utilize their foreign driving license for up to six months. After this duration, a German driving license is needed. If your license is not in German, it is suggested to bring an International Driving Permit (IDP).

3. Can I update my driving license category?
Yes, applicants can update their driving license classifications by completing the needed theoretical and useful training for the new category and passing the tests.
4. What takes place if I fail the driving test?
If you do not pass either the theoretical or dry run on the very first attempt, you can retake the tests. There is normally a waiting period of a few weeks before you can schedule a retake.
5. What if I lose my driving license?
If your driving license is lost or stolen, report it to the local police and apply for a replacement at your regional Fahrerlaubnisbehörde. You will need to provide proof of identity and submit a replacement application.
